New VPS offering to be a more affordable and reliable solution to dedicated servers.
HostRail.com, a web host and an internet solutions provider, today announced that it will begin offering Virtual Private Servers. The company states that it continues to offer hosting options that are cutting edge and more than turn-key solutions.
It claims that it provides internet services on a reliable grid technology and it avers that the new "Fat" VPS packages have integrated control panels and provide complete control with root access. The Linux-based VPSs are Ruby-on-Rails ready and run on Dual Xeon servers.
It further explains that its VPS packages include bandwidth options between 500GB and 2000GB with disk space options between 144 GB and 546GB on dual drives. The three package options range in price from $19.99 to $69.99 monthly.
